Abstract

1,175,492. Sodium trimetaphosphate. FMC CORP. 14 Feb., 1968, No. 7209/68. Heading C1A. Sodium metaphosphate is prepared by continuously feeding an aqueous solution of sodium phosphate(s) (Na2O: P2O5 ratio from 0À99 to 1À00) containing from 70-73% wt. of phos. phate, preferably NaH2PO4, at temperatures which are suitably between 100-110‹ C. through an elongated reaction vessel; feeding combustion gases at a temperature between 800-850‹ C. continuously in a countercurrent fashion through the vessel and removing the calcined product at a temperature of 520- 580‹ C. from the reaction vessel, the total residence time being about three hours, twothirds of which represents the time for complete drying and the remainder the calcination period. The process is suitably carried out in a rotary kiln and provides a product containing less than 0À5% wt. of water insolubles.
